Job Description
Cascade Animal Clinic has been operating in Monroe for over forty years. We have a high client retention rate and strong presence in the community. We are open Monday through Friday with no on call or weekend hours. We are an appointment-based clinic and offer same day Prompt Care for pets' more urgent needs. With a robust and diverse caseload, our team routinely provides: Wellness care and vaccinations Internal medicine Soft tissue surgeries Dentistry procedures Urgent care Our full-time team members typically work 4-day workweeks, allowing for plenty of 3-day weekends. We also have a strong mentorship program for staff in all positions, and we are dedicated to continued learning.
What we expect from you:
Valid WA Veterinary Medication Clerk License in good standing or eligible to obtain within 3-6 months of hire (we will help you!). 1 or more years of clinical veterinary experience. While we do welcome newcomers to the field, our current opening is for someone with prior experience. Desire to continuously learn Genuine love of animals and the people who love them. Proficiency in core technical skills including animal handling, venipuncture, and administering medications. Knowledge of medical mathematics and terminology and apply them to your everyday work. Ability to recognize patient symptoms through own observations and patient histories and determine the urgency with which a patient must be treated. Strong organizational and time management skills The ability to adapt quickly to the ever-changing needs within a hospital on a day-to-day basis. Exercise attention to detail in all aspects of work, with an understanding that the difference between performing a task correctly vs. incorrectly can be life-changing for patients. Approach mistakes as an opportunity to learn, whether they were your own or someone else's. Excellent interpersonal and communication skills that allow you to build rapport with clients and team members, fostering trust and loyalty. A "can do" attitude and commitment to embrace challenges and to dedicate yourself to continuous learning and improvement. A willingness to support the hospital and team in any way needed to achieve positive patient and client outcomes.Core Responsibilities:
Be willing to grow and learn, be comfortable asking questions, and be willing to explore new ways of working. Utilize your expertise to assist veterinarians in examinations, diagnostics, and treatments, ensuring the comfort and well-being of our patients. Perform technical skills such as placing IVCs, administering treatments, and running diagnostic tests with the utmost care and precision. Be a trusted resource for pet parents, providing guidance on preventative care, nutrition, and behavior to promote optimal health and quality of life. Champion our commitment to exceptional patient care by maintaining accurate medical records and ensuring hospital processes and protocols are followed. Foster a supportive and collaborative team environment by sharing your knowledge, skills, and passion for veterinary medicine. Communicate with all team members, staff, vendors, and visitors in a respectful, professional manner while promoting the doctors' recommendations, hospital vision and goals, and your team.
